Dexamethasone + gentamicin + metronidazole is a triple-drug combination therapy utilized primarily in oral and maxillofacial surgery for the management of postoperative complications. Developed and extensively studied by institutions such as The Sixth Affiliated Hospital of Sun Yat-Sen University, this combination is typically applied locally to the extraction socket following the removal of mandibular impacted third molars. Dexamethasone, a potent synthetic glucocorticoid, serves to mitigate the inflammatory response, thereby reducing postoperative pain, edema, and trismus. Gentamicin, an aminoglycoside antibiotic, provides broad-spectrum bactericidal activity against aerobic gram-negative pathogens, while metronidazole, a nitroimidazole, specifically targets anaerobic bacteria that are common in the oral cavity and associated with alveolar osteitis (dry socket). The synergistic effect of these three agents aims to promote faster healing and minimize the incidence of infection and inflammatory complications.
